Beyond Border-Radius: CSS corner-shape Property for Everyday UI
- Creator: Smashing Magazine editorial team
- Style: CSS-driven UI exploration; technical typography and layout design
- What makes it great: For years,
border-radiuswas the ceiling of corner design — round or nothing. Smashing Magazine's deep-dive, published just weeks ago, reveals that the new CSScorner-shapeproperty finally opens the door to beveled, scooped, and squircle corners natively in the browser. The article demonstrates how this single property fundamentally changes what's achievable without resorting to SVG hacks or JavaScript, and the included code examples showcase how compositionally rich UI shapes can now be authored purely in CSS. The composition of code samples alongside visual comparisons is crisp and educational, making it immediately actionable for production use.

UI/UX Strategies for Generative AI Applications
- Creator: TheFinch Design
- Style: Product design / AI interaction design; UX pattern documentation
- What makes it great: Published this week, this piece tackles one of design's most pressing open questions: how do you design for creation itself? The article lays out practical UX patterns for prompt flows, output refinement, and human–AI collaboration in generative AI tools. Its breakdown of trust markers — subtle design signals that tell users when AI is acting versus when they are in control — addresses a gap that most AI product teams are still figuring out. The visual hierarchy of the examples is clean and the pattern library approach makes this immediately useful for product designers shipping AI features. Design Deep Dive
TheFinch Design's generative AI UX pattern guide deserves a closer look than a single pick entry allows. The article's core contribution is a taxonomy of design states unique to generative tools: the empty state (before a prompt), the generative state (while AI is working), the refinement state (post-output editing), and the approval state (human confirms). Most current AI tools conflate these states visually, which creates cognitive friction and erodes trust.
The layout decisions are sharp: each pattern is presented as a named, visually isolated component, not buried in prose. The color palette in the examples uses desaturated blues and cool grays to signal "AI zone" — a subtle but consistent trust signal the article explicitly names and justifies. Typography uses distinct size hierarchies between prompt input (larger, inviting) and AI output (slightly smaller, contained), reinforcing the human-leads-AI relationship. This is interaction design that argues a position through its own visual choices, not just documents patterns.
Trends & Techniques
-
corner-shapeCSS as a new design system primitive: The arrival of native browser support for beveled, scooped, and squircle corners is not just a visual novelty — it's a token-level design decision that will ripple into component libraries, Figma variable sets, and brand systems. Teams that adopt it early will differentiate their UI vocabulary; teams that ignore it risk shipping visually dated interfaces as browsers push the property into mainstream support. -
Intent-driven AI interfaces replacing feature-driven AI interfaces: Multiple sources this week — from TheFinch's generative AI UX guide to uxdesign.cc's trend forecasting — converge on the same signal: the next phase of AI UI is about designing for what users intend, not what features the model offers. This manifests as prompt-scaffolding UX, progressive disclosure of AI capabilities, and trust markers that clarify AI versus human action. Designers who can articulate and prototype these states will be in high demand.
-
Framer for production, Figma for systems: The Figma vs. Framer conversation has matured in 2026. Current commentary (including Muzli's detailed comparison) now frames it clearly: Figma owns design systems, component logic, and stakeholder communication; Framer owns production-ready web output and live interactions. Teams shipping marketing sites and landing pages are increasingly designing in both — not choosing between them. This dual-tool fluency is becoming a baseline expectation for product designers working on web-facing work.
